Job Summary
We are seeking a skilled and motivated Maintenance Technician with experience in mechanical, electrical, hydraulic, and pneumatic systems. The ideal candidate will be responsible for diagnosing, repairing, and maintaining a variety of systems and equipment in a high-paced, technical environment. This is a hands-on role that requires strong troubleshooting skills, attention to detail, and the ability to work effectively with engineering and operations teams.
Job Description
- Diagnose and resolve mechanical issues including the replacement of parts such as pressure pumps, thermocouples, tooling, treating iron, and tubing.
- Troubleshoot and repair hydraulic systems, including control valves, pumps, motors, cylinders, and pressure hoses.
- Perform basic electrical diagnostics and repairs, including work with VFDs, motors, 4-20mA and 24V sensors, and PLC/RMC controllers.
- Identify and resolve pneumatic issues, including troubleshooting of control valves, cylinders, vacuum systems, and basic compressor systems.
- Conduct preventative maintenance on pumps, compressors, drivers, and auxiliary equipment.
- Rig downhole tools into pressure vessels or bunkers, connect high-pressure tubing, and conduct pressure tests using HMI remote control and data acquisition systems.
- Use Microsoft Word, Excel, and other computer tools for maintenance and test reporting.
- Communicate effectively with engineers, supervisors, and other departments in both verbal and written formats.
- Other duties as assigned, based on business needs.
